AUDITIONS FOR ICE HOUSE THEATER
BERKELEY SPRINGS, WV ---- The Morgan Arts Council is holding auditions
for the Ice House Theater Project's production of "The Importance of
Being Earnest" by Oscar Wilde. Auditions are scheduled for 6pm on
Wednesday and Thursday, February 24 and 25 at the Ice House.
Prospective actors may attend either audition.
There are parts for five males and four females and all are open to be
cast.
"Earnest" is a Victorian romantic farce with mistaken identities and
lots of laughs. "For all aspiring comedic actors, this is an
opportunity not to be missed," says Margi Griffiths, the show's
director. Griffiths outlines the needed actors as two young women and
two young men in their late 20s; two women and two men, middle aged;
a butler and a manservant. "This is an ideal play for this area,"
says Griffiths. "The two middle age women are Fairfaxes." Griffiths
also promises that everyone will love the costumes.
Rehearsals start in March. Performances are two weekends: April 22
through May 2 at the Ice House. The Ice House is located at
Independence and Mercer in downtown Berkeley Springs.
